Have your kids finished all the easy chapter books they can handle? Do you want to advance their reading skills to the next level? If they want longer chapters with fewer illustrations, check out these fun reads for older kids who have mastered basic reading skills.

Poppleton books by Cynthia Rylant for beginning early readers

Poppleton: These short stories come grouped in three per book, making them great for young readers. Poppleton the pig explores dilemmas both big and small with a positive attitude. Readers, meanwhile, can enjoy the large text and black and white illustrations sprinkled throughout the pages.

Pet Rescue Club: These chapter books make a great transition to longer, more complex series. This set features Janey, who can’t have pets because of allergies. But she doesn’t let that stop her. In each of the eight books, a different pet needs help. The longer chapters with more text help kids build their reading stamina, while the story captures their hearts and imaginations.

Magnificent Makers: Violet and Pablo love learning about science in this series of stories. These two third grade kids discover the Maker Maze, a magical place of exploration and discovery. Each of the six books in the series addresses a different scientific concept, like germs or outer space. Kids will enjoy the topics tailored for their age level while learning more than reading skills.

Magic Tree House: This series features historical and mythical events explored by two intrepid young kids who discover a time-traveling treehouse. Each book takes place in a different setting, and includes facts and figures about the scene. Let kids’ imaginations run wild, from the jungle to Camelot, with this fun set of books.

I Survived: These fictional historical excerpts showcase real events told from the perspective of kids who experienced them firsthand. From floods to the ravages of war, kids can discover places and times rich with details. With twenty books to choose from, readers can journey through time.

Mrs. Piggle-Wiggle: This delightful inhabitant of an upside-down house has a cure for children’s worst habits. She delights in sharing her treasure trove of solutions with a neighborhood full of mischievous kids. Readers will enjoy the trouble and the amusing antics of all the characters that populate this light-hearted take on bad behaviors.

Dragon Masters: This series contains more than 25 books about dragons. Set in a fantasy world where dragons team up with humans to fight evil, each book focuses on a specific type of dragon and their chosen master. Readers will delight in the triumph over evil, while short chapters packed with action will keep them turning the pages and begging for the next book in this extensive series.
